Hello everyone,

The pipeline I help support needs to be able to access the metadata from raw footage in an automated way. Up till now we've been using an old CentOS specific Arri Meta Extract command line tool to get the info we need.

Unfortunately, the build of the Meta Extract command line tool we have dies on the newer Alexa Mini mxf files. Looking at the support section, it looks like Arri doesn't even release a CentOS/RHEL version of the arri meta extract tool anymore.

Has anyone else run into a similar problem and been able to come up with a resolution? I'm surprised there's not a linux version released due to the number of major professional facilities I know that run their infrastructure in Linux.
